Shettima Storms Zamfara as Governor Lawal, Thousands Defect to APC

Vice President Kashim Shettima on Tuesday arrived in Zamfara State to formally welcome Governor Dauda Lawal into the All Progressives Congress (APC), marking one of the most significant political realignments in the North-West ahead of the 2027 general elections.

Shettima, who represented President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, touched down in Gusau for a grand reception organised at the Trade Fair Complex to receive the governor, members of his cabinet, and thousands of supporters defecting from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P).

According to a statement issued by the Senior Special Assistant to the President on Media and Communications, Stanley Nkwocha, the Vice President was received by an influential bloc of political heavyweights.

Present at the airport were the governors of Jigawa, Kaduna, Ogun, and Adamawa Umar Namadi, Uba Sani, Dapo Abiodun, and Ahmadu Fintiri as well as the governors of Plateau, Kano and Sokoto, Caleb Mutfwang, Abba Kabir Yusuf and Ahmad Aliyu.

Also in attendance to receive Shettima were the Deputy Senate President, the Speaker of the House of Representatives, the APC National Chairman, the APC Governors’ Forum Chairman, Governor Hope Uzodinma, ministers, lawmakers and top party chieftains.

Governor Lawal officially dumped the PDP on March 9 after weeks of political consultations with stakeholders across the state.

A statement previously issued by the Zamfara PDP described the defection as a decision taken in the interest of stability, progress and sustainable development for the state.

The Vice President’s visit and the high-powered delegation accompanying him signal the APC’s growing consolidation in the North-West, as the party intensifies efforts to expand its influence and unify political structures across the region ahead of major national contests.
